In a dramatic escalation, Israeli forces intercepted and boarded the Gaza-bound civilian aid ship Handala in international waters, cutting live video feeds mid-broadcast. The vessel, carrying unarmed activists, medics, and parliamentarians from 12 countries, was part of the Freedom Flotilla mission aimed at breaking Israel’s blockade on Gaza. Moments before the hijacking, passengers sat peacefully on deck, raising their hands and singing the anti-fascist anthem Bella Ciao. All communication was lost shortly after. Human rights groups have condemned the operation as a violation of international law. This marks the third Israeli interception of a humanitarian mission this year.

Treasury minister James Murray has said the only way to achieve lasting peace in the Middle East is through a two-state solution. Speaking about the crisis in Gaza, he described the situation as “utterly horrifying” and said the UK is pushing for a ceasefire, aid access and hostage releases. He stressed the Prime Minister is in talks with international leaders to help get “on that pathway to a two-state solution.” Report by Covellm. Kemi Badenoch has rejected calls for the UK to recognise Palestinian statehood, saying doing so now would “reward” Hamas after its October attack. The leader of the Conservative Party said a two-state solution remains the goal but “now is not the time.” On the humanitarian crisis in Gaza, she called images of starving civilians “heartbreaking” and blamed Hamas for prolonging the war.
